"Sporting the "America" appellation, the 1996 Merlot is medium to dark ruby-colored, and reveals a spicy oak and jammy blackberry nose. Medium to full-bodied, ample, oily textured, and sexy, this lovely Merlot is crammed with ripe red and black fruits as well as eucalyptus. This sensual offering's attack and mid-palate lead to a somewhat tannic finish that will require a year or two of cellaring." -Robert Parker
